VAG EEPROM Programmer v1.20 is a third-party Windows tool designed to read, write, and repair EEPROM data from immobilizer units, instrument clusters, and ECUs in VAG vehicles (roughly 1995–2005). It works with specific USB programmers (e.g., VAG-TACHO, Carprog, or generic CH341A/FTDI adapters).

Understanding EEPROM and Its Significance in Automotive Electronics

EEPROM (Electrically Erasable Programmable Read-Only Memory) is a type of non-volatile memory used in electronic devices, including automotive ECUs. It stores data that can be erased and reprogrammed, which is crucial for updating software, configuring settings, and fine-tuning vehicle performance. In the context of VAG vehicles, EEPROM plays a pivotal role in engine management, transmission control, and various other systems.

The VAG EEPROM Programmer 1.20 is a specialized automotive diagnostic tool designed for technicians and advanced hobbyists working with the Volkswagen Audi Group (VAG) ecosystem, including VW, Audi, Skoda, and Seat vehicles. It is primarily used to read, write, and modify data stored in the Electrically Erasable Programmable Read-Only Memory (EEPROM) of various control modules without requiring hardware disassembly in many cases. Core Functions and Capabilities

The 1.20 version serves as a comprehensive diagnostic solution for older K-line-based platforms, typically covering vehicles produced between 1997 and 2003.

EEPROM Operations: Allows users to read and write the hex dump of EEPROM chips, such as the 24Cxx, 93Cxx, and 95xxx families.

Immobilizer Support: Extracts critical security data, including PIN and SKC (Secret Key Code), which is necessary for programming new keys or replacing instrument clusters.

Odometer Correction: Enables mileage reading and calibration on supported instrument clusters (where legal).

Airbag Data Recovery: Can clear and reset airbag crash data after a collision, allowing the SRS system to be reused without expensive OEM replacements. Applications of VAG EEPROM Programmer 1

You install a used cluster from a donor car. The car won’t start due to IMMO mismatch. You read the dump from the new cluster, edit the VIN and IMMO ID to match the original car, recalculate the checksum, and write it back. The cluster now works perfectly.

Version 1.20 is an incremental update over the widely used 1.19g, focusing on interface usability and broader hardware compatibility. Expanded Functionality

: Supports reading/writing EEPROM, extracting Immobilizer login codes (PINs), clearing SRS Airbag crash data, and reading/clearing fault codes (DTCs) across multiple modules like ABS and Central Locking. Improved UI

: Features a larger window display (6 additional lines visible) and an optimized color scheme for better readability. Driver Integration

: Includes built-in virtual COM port drivers, simplifying the setup on modern Windows systems compared to older versions. Language Support

: The interface is available in English, German, Danish, and Romanian. Performance Review
